How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help Actually Works

In Alabama, expungement refers to the legal process of sealing or erasing qualifying records from public view. This means that, in many situations, the record will no longer appear during standard background checks.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help begins with determining whether a case qualifies under state law. Not every arrest or conviction can be expunged, and eligibility depends on the charge, the outcome, and the amount of time that has passed. For example, some first-time drug possession cases or dismissed charges may be eligible, while violent offenses typically are not. An experienced attorney reviews the specific details and explains what the law allows in a particular situation.

Once eligibility is confirmed, the process involves preparing and filing court documents. This often includes completing specific forms, paying required fees, and sometimes attending a hearing. Many people find this stage confusing because of deadlines, procedural rules, and variations between counties.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help when a lawyer manages these steps correctly and on time. They help ensure that all paperwork is accurate and meet local court expectations. If a hearing is required, the attorney may present the case clearly and professionally. After approval, the court issues an order, and eligible records are either sealed or destroyed according to the law. Understanding this step-by-step approach reduces uncertainty and helps people feel more in control of their future.

Common Questions People Have About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help

One of the most common questions is how long the process takes from start to finish. In Alabama, the timeline can vary depending on the court’s schedule, the type of case, and whether any issues arise. Simple cases may move more quickly, while others could take several months. Another frequent question is whether expungement truly removes records from every database. While an expungement order directs government agencies to seal or destroy records, private databases may not update immediately or at all. This is why it is important to have realistic expectations and professional guidance.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help by explaining these factors honestly and clearly.

People also often ask about costs and whether expungement is worth the investment. Fees generally include court costs and attorney fees, but the exact amount depends on the complexity of the case. Some individuals qualify for waivers or reduced fees, which an attorney can help explain. Another common concern is whether expungement affects certain professional licenses or government benefits. In many cases, expunged records do not need to be disclosed, but there are exceptions, especially in regulated fields or government employment.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help by reviewing these details in advance so clients can make informed decisions. By addressing these questions openly, it becomes easier to understand both the benefits and the limitations of the process.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A widespread myth is that expungement completely destroys all records forever. In reality, some government agencies and law enforcement may still access sealed records under specific conditions. Another misunderstanding is that an expungement works the same way in every state. Alabama law has its own requirements, timelines, and restrictions that differ from others. Clearing Your Record: How an Alabama Expungement Lawyer Can Help by clarifying these distinctions and preventing confusion. Believing that a record will vanish entirely can lead to surprises later in background checks or applications.

Some people also assume that if charges were dropped or the case ended without a conviction, the record will automatically disappear. In Alabama, this is not always true, and deadlines for filing may pass without action. Without help, individuals might miss important steps or misunderstand how the law applies to their situation. A knowledgeable attorney can correct these missteps early and protect their client’s interests. Clearing up these points builds trust and ensures that people understand exactly what expungement can and cannot do.
